Output 5a89b327c041f765657314f093d9e9ac4535ab83585618040ca628fa61126659:63

value
417500
script pubkey
OP_0 OP_PUSHBYTES_32 e404d63d7f51c67ee53f8bd2fb8517f0e59aded73c23a0f1ccb6bf529a8859ae
address
bc1quszdv0tl28r8aefl30f0hpgh7rje4hkh8s36puwvk6l49x5gtxhqt55dss
transaction
5a89b327c041f765657314f093d9e9ac4535ab83585618040ca628fa61126659
spent
true